200-1682 7th Ave W Vancouver, BC, V6J 4S6
604-664-8901
Vancouver Computers - Networking
207-1682 7th Ave W Vancouver, BC, V6J 4S6
604-742-2230
Vancouver Midwives
2055 Rosser Ave Burnaby, BC, V5B 0A4
604-299-5778
Burnaby Social & Human Service Organizations
9889 140 St Surrey, BC, V3T 4M4
778-316-2625
Surrey Drug Abuse & Addiction Information & Treatment
38 1st Ave E BC, V5T 1A1
604-873-8000
Dental Laboratories
1-1701 Grant St Vancouver, BC, V5L 2Y6
604-251-1322
Vancouver Dentists
10515 King George Blvd Surrey, BC, V3T 2X1
Surrey Dentists
108-2828 152 St Surrey, BC, V4P 1G6
604-531-8222
Surrey Veterinarians
10519 King George Blvd Surrey, BC, V3T 2X1
604-585-3355
Surrey Pharmacies
129-3388 Rosemary Heights Cres Surrey, BC, V3Z 0K7
778-294-8732
Surrey Psychologists, Therapy & Psychology
204-1529 6th Ave W Vancouver, BC, V6J 1R1
604-733-7709
Vancouver Psychologists, Therapy & Psychology
317-1529 6th Ave W Vancouver, BC, V6J 1R1
604-565-7342
Vancouver Dental Hygienists
210-1529 6th Avenue W Vancouver, BC, V6J 1R1
604-974-1366
Vancouver Medical & Surgical Services Organizations
1655 Main St Vancouver, BC, V6A 2W5
604-563-7200
Vancouver Dentists
2127 Granville St Vancouver, BC, V6H 3E9
604-671-0293
Vancouver Property Management
2146 Broadway W Vancouver, BC, V6K 2C8
604-697-0466
Vancouver Vitamins & Supplements
2190 West Broadway Vancouver, BC, V6K 2C8
604-670-6842
Vancouver Tax Consultants
580-2184W Broadway W Vancouver, BC, V6K 2E1
604-738-8448
104-13401 108 Ave Surrey, BC, V3T 5T3
604-930-0755
Surrey Dentists
230-2184 Broadway W Vancouver, BC, V6K 2E1
604-736-2330
Vancouver Dentists
580-2184 Broadway W Vancouver, BC, V6K 2E1
604-738-8012
Vancouver Dentists
209-15252 32 Ave Surrey, BC, V3S 0R7
604-536-4222
110-15252 32 Avenue Surrey, BC, V3Z 0R7
604-536-7697
Surrey Dentists
105-15252 32nd Avenue Surrey, BC, V3Z 0R7
604-536-2224
Surrey Physiotherapists
4399 Lougheed Hwy Burnaby, BC, V5C 3Y7
604-298-8412
Burnaby Grocery Stores & Markets
3619 18th Ave W Vancouver, BC, V6S 1B3
604-736-5705
Vancouver Dentists
15122 72 Avenue Surrey, BC, V3S 2G2
Surrey Optometrists
604-580-2603
The 1st Choice For Over A Half Century. 100+ Trucks to Satisfy Your Plumbing, Drainage & Heating Needs. Fast, Fair, Reliable. 24 Hours a Day, 7 Days a Week
Surrey Duct Cleaning
102-15303 31 Avenue Surrey, BC, V3Z 6X2
604-538-8338
Surrey Physiotherapists
2219 Broadway W Vancouver, BC, V6K 2E4
604-733-1022
Vancouver Dentists
4453 Lougheed Hwy Burnaby, BC, V5C 3Z2
604-428-1363
Burnaby Physicians & Surgeons
13817 103 Avenue Surrey, BC, V3T 5B5
604-930-4517
13817 103 Avenue Surrey, BC, V3T 5B5
604-495-4200
Surrey Physiotherapists
1901 Rosser Avenue Burnaby, BC, V5C 6R6
604-733-4867
Burnaby Dentists
206-15350 34 Avenue Surrey, BC, V3Z 0X7
604-542-7874
Surrey Dentists
2217 Broadway W Vancouver, BC, V6K 2E4
604-568-7005
10690 135A St Surrey, BC, V3T 4E2
604-582-1068
Surrey Drug Abuse & Addiction Information & Treatment
104-10663 King George Blvd Surrey, BC, V3T 2X6
604-256-9572
Surrey Tax Consultants
1630 5th Ave W Vancouver, BC, V6J 1N8
604-736-7946
Vancouver Health Clubs & Fitness Centres
2460 152 Street Surrey, BC, V4P 1M8
604-536-7618
Surrey Physicians & Surgeons
2460 152 Street Surrey, BC, V4P 1M8
604-536-7618
Surrey Physicians & Surgeons
2460 152 Street Surrey, BC, V4P 1M8
604-536-7618
Surrey Veterinarians
447 East Columbia New Westminster, BC, V3L 3X3
604-553-1236
New Westminster Hearing Aids & Accessories
240-4664 Lougheed Hwy Burnaby, BC, V5C 5T5
604-299-4001
Burnaby Social & Human Service Organizations
10608 King George Blvd Surrey, BC, V3T 2X3
604-588-4636
Surrey Dentists
101-450 Columbia St E New Westminster, BC, V3L 3X5
604-553-1203
New Westminster Physiotherapists
111-2251 Holdom Ave Burnaby, BC, V5B 0A2
604-366-3464
Burnaby Private Medical Care
2382 152 St Surrey, BC, V4A 4N9
604-541-7374
Surrey Veterinarians
102-4353 Halifax St Burnaby, BC, V5C 5Z4
604-291-8616
Burnaby Apartment Rental Agencies
1590 W 4th Ave Vancouver, BC, V6J 1L7
604-734-5104
Vancouver Veterinarians